Default Classic cat help

Hey gang, I've got a 93 WRX import and the exhaust has gone on the first cat.
I've been trawling around on e-bay looking for a replacement, but could do with some advice before I go spending any money.
I'm pretty sure the U.K. and imports cats are different.
Would a cat from any import motor fit mine (like an STI) or do I specifically need a WRX one?.
I've also read somewhere that a cat from an import turbo Forrester is the same, is that correct?.
My other option is to go for a de-cat fr pipe, but that still leaves me with having to sort a replacement cat for the mot later.
Would appreciate any help on this one.

All GC8 OE front pipes will fit, UK,WRX,STi are all the same.
The only difference was the early Version 1 & 2 had no whole for the lambda sensor whereas the Version 3 > 6 did, in this case you could buy and fit a lambda bung (about £10.00).

You only have 1 cat (downpipe) and you don't need one to pass the emissions test as pre July or Sept (can't remember which) has an easier emissions test.

Sorry forgot to say the year DOH it's pre July/Sept 1995. Decat pipe is about £150ish depending on who makes it.
